Creating a brand for your business can be a daunting task, but it doesn’t have to be. With a little creativity and some help from a business name generator, you can create a unique and memorable brand that will help you stand out from the competition.
Here are 15 tips to get you started:
- Decide what message you want to communicate with your brand. What do you want people to think of when they see your name or logo? This will be the foundation of your brand identity.
- Keep it simple. A complex name or logo will be difficult for people to remember and could turn them off from doing business with you.
- Make sure your name is easy to spell and pronounce. You don’t want people to have to guess how to spell your name or what it sounds like.
- Do some research? Make sure the name you choose isn’t already being used by another company in your industry.
- Be different. Don’t choose a name that’s similar to other businesses in your industry. This will make it difficult for people to remember and could confuse them about which brand they’re dealing with.
- Consider using a made-up word. This can be an effective way to create a unique and memorable brand identity. Just make sure the word is easy to pronounce and spell.
- Use a business name generator. This can be a great way to brainstorm ideas and find a unique and available name for your business.
- Get feedback from others. Once you’ve come up with a few potential names, run them by family and friends to see what they think.
- Make sure the name you choose is available. Once you’ve settled on a name, do a quick search online to make sure it’s available to use.
- Choose a name that can grow with you. As your business grows and changes, you want a name that will still be relevant and easy to remember.
- Avoid using trends. A trendy name may help you stand out now, but it could date your business quickly and make it difficult to rebrand in the future.
- Keep it timeless. Choose a name that won’t be easily forgotten and will still be relevant in 10 or 20 years.
- Consider your target audience. When choosing a name, make sure it’s something that will appeal to your target market.
- Make sure the domain name is available. Once you’ve chosen a name, check to see if the corresponding domain name is available. If it’s not, you may want to consider another name.
- Protect your brand. Once you’ve created your brand identity, it’s important to protect it. Register your trademark and make sure you have the legal rights to use the name and logo before moving forward.
